New safety center is a welcome step toward 'One NASA'
The Columbia accident has given the U.S. an opportunity to correct a flaw that has hobbled its space exploration enterprise from the beginning. Cobbled together from a disparate array of Cold War research labs, NASA has never really overcome the parochial pull of its field centers as it pushed...
